RUNBOOK 7.1 — Signed Contract Transfers

Signed contracts move between the Larkspur and Veddon offices twice weekly in sealed red pouches. On arrival, the receiving site checks pouch seals, counts documents against the transfer slip, and stores them in the contracts safe within one hour. Any broken seal triggers an incident report. Accept the courier only per the confidential instruction below.

courier memo of yahif-faweg: the quenael tamius courier leaves the prawyn jorix kaswyn istox silmir brieth zormir fenvan ledger at gate 3145 under passcode 231062

Action item: The Relayn deploy-status bot silently dropped updates when the pipeline API paginated results, so responders believed a rollback had completed when it had not. We will add pagination handling, a staleness banner, and an integration test. Until merged, verify deploy state directly in the pipeline console, documented at the page below.

runbook for kahop-kajop: https://rundeck.ordinio.test/display/secrets/pipeline/issue/pages/repo/browse/e5732776e07d1285107e5aeb

MEMO — Vendale Distribution, Shift Leads

The Q3 stock-count ledger for the Orrick Lane warehouse is finalised and bound. It travels by courier to head office Friday, sealed in the grey document pouch. Do not photocopy or open the pouch once sealed. When the courier from Tillbrook Express arrives, apply the hand-over instruction given below.

dispatch memo: the eliath belael courier leaves the praox ledger at gate 8841 under passcode 017589

**Ticket #4471 — DateShape sandbox env misconfigured**

Hey plugin folks — if your locale previews in the DateShape sandbox are rendering everything as ISO-8601, that's on us. The sandbox shipped without the formatting service credentials, so it silently falls back to defaults. Fix: open your sandbox `.env` and make sure it ends with the line granting formatter access, shown below.

secret setting of tahop-yagaf: COURIER_KEY8=3821f1bd